I may need to replace the PROM. GM , I understand, has discontinued them, and I have had no luck on the internet with the usual suppliers. Can anyone recommend a source? Thanks!
 
Price on a OEM chip when they were last available was $400+
PCMfor less ( and other tuners ) will do you a custom chip for $150

http://www.pcmforless.com/index.php?option=com_wrapper&Itemid=316

You can make any changes you want like
turn fans on earlier , delete the VATS ,change torque convertor lock up speed (to prevent that low speed lockup that some find annoying) ,etc
